Job description, responsibilities and duties

Under supervision, provide support enabling the accurate and timely payment administration to our network of project sites. Perform duties in accordance with company Finance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), Sarbanes-Oxley Controls and Unit Service Level agreements (if applicable).


RESPONSIBILITIES


• Managing site invoices and providing oversight on the entire process. Ability to form remote relationships with colleagues across the globe, consider indirect influences on your work and manage these.
• Highlighting aged invoices and financial risks – give reasons why for any delays
• Checks for Data Protection compliance
• Checks for invoicing legal requirements and compliance to existing contracts
• Reconciliations
• Payment cycle target trending – ensuring the studies are meeting the target for each step in the invoice payment cycle
• Providing high level of customer service to internal project teams and assisting them in any invoicing related issues by finding resolution. Ability to influence others and ensure that key actions are taken
• Track and report metric data flagging nonstandard issues to project teams / line manager
• Provide assistance to other team members as required, to ensure the group meets targets. .
• Provide support and participate in teams handling various routine tasks.
• Provide standard reports and run KPI for stakeholders
• Perform other duties as assigned.
• Help to evolve and change processes
• Communication with sites
